Subject: Re: [PATCH v13 05/11] soc: mediatek: Add multiple step bus protection control

Hi Wiyi Lu,

Thank you for your patch.

Missatge de Weiyi Lu <weiyi.lu@...iatek.com> del dia dv., 20 de març
2020 a les 8:33:
>
> Both MT8183 & MT6765 have more control steps of bus protection
> than previous project. And there add more bus protection registers
> reside at infracfg & smi-common.
> Extend function to support multiple step bus protection control
> with more customized arguments.
> And then use bp_table for bus protection of all compatibles,
> instead of mixing bus_prot_mask and bus_prot_reg_update.
>
> Signed-off-by: Weiyi Lu <weiyi.lu@...iatek.com>
> ---
>  drivers/soc/mediatek/mtk-scpsys.c | 206 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------
>  drivers/soc/mediatek/scpsys.h     |  42 +++++++-
>  2 files changed, 182 insertions(+), 66 deletions(-)

> +static int set_bus_protection(struct regmap *map, struct bus_prot *bp)
> +{
> +       u32 val;
> +       u32 set_ofs = bp->set_ofs;
> +       u32 en_ofs = bp->en_ofs;
> +       u32 sta_ofs = bp->sta_ofs;
> +       u32 mask = bp->mask;

Remove unnecessary local variables (set_ofs, en_ofs, sta_ofs and
mask), and use their bp-> form directly.

> +
> +       if (set_ofs)
> +               regmap_write(map, set_ofs, mask);
> +       else
> +               regmap_update_bits(map, en_ofs, mask, mask);
> +
> +       return regmap_read_poll_timeout(map, sta_ofs,
> +                       val, (val & mask) == mask,
> +                       MTK_POLL_DELAY_US, MTK_POLL_TIMEOUT);
> +}
> +
> +static int clear_bus_protection(struct regmap *map, struct bus_prot *bp)
> +{
> +       u32 val;
> +       u32 clr_ofs = bp->clr_ofs;
> +       u32 en_ofs = bp->en_ofs;
> +       u32 sta_ofs = bp->sta_ofs;
> +       u32 mask = bp->mask;
> +       bool ignore_ack = bp->ignore_clr_ack;

Remove unnecessary local variables (clr_ofs, en_ofs, sta_ofs, mask and
ignore_ack), and use their bp-> form directly.

> +
> +       if (clr_ofs)
> +               regmap_write(map, clr_ofs, mask);
> +       else
> +               regmap_update_bits(map, en_ofs, mask, 0);
> +
> +       if (ignore_ack)
> +               return 0;
> +
> +       return regmap_read_poll_timeout(map, sta_ofs,
> +                       val, !(val & mask),
> +                       MTK_POLL_DELAY_US, MTK_POLL_TIMEOUT);
> +}
> +
>  static int scpsys_bus_protect_enable(struct scp_domain *scpd)
>  {
>         struct scp *scp = scpd->scp;
> +       const struct bus_prot *bp_table = scpd->data->bp_table;
>         struct regmap *infracfg = scp->infracfg;
> -       u32 mask = scpd->data->bus_prot_mask;
> -       bool reg_update = scp->bus_prot_reg_update;
> -       u32 val;
> -       int ret;

No need to remove ret if you're going to add anyway later.

> +       struct regmap *smi_common = scp->smi_common;
> +       int i;
>
> -       if (!mask)
> -               return 0;
> +       for (i = 0; i < MAX_STEPS; i++) {
> +               struct regmap *map = NULL;

Declare this on top of the function and no need to initialize to NUlL

> +               int ret;
> +               struct bus_prot bp = bp_table[i];

Unneeded local variable ...

>
> -       if (reg_update)
> -               regmap_update_bits(infracfg, INFRA_TOPAXI_PROTECTEN, mask,
> -                               mask);
> -       else
> -               regmap_write(infracfg, INFRA_TOPAXI_PROTECTEN_SET, mask);
> +               if (bp.type == IFR_TYPE)

bp_table[i].type?

> +                       map = infracfg;
> +               else if (bp.type == SMI_TYPE)

ditto

> +                       map = smi_common;
> +               else
> +                       break;

So if the type is invalid you break the loop, this is different to
what you are doing below with the scpsys_bus_protect_protect_disable()
function where you are "ignoring" instead of beaking the loop. I am
wondering why? Looks to me that, or you break and print an error
because something was really wrong? or you ignore in both cases?

>
> -       ret = regmap_read_poll_timeout(infracfg, INFRA_TOPAXI_PROTECTSTA1,
> -                                      val, (val & mask) == mask,
> -                                      MTK_POLL_DELAY_US, MTK_POLL_TIMEOUT);
> +               ret = set_bus_protection(map, &bp);
>
> -       return ret;
> +               if (ret)
> +                       return ret;
> +       }
> +
> +       return 0;
>  }
